The OccluSense® system consists of the handheld device, inductive charger, a test sensor, and one box of 25 OccluSense® sensors.
OccluSense® Handheld Device
The new system developed by Bausch combines the traditional and digital
registration of the pressure distribution on occlusal surfaces. The
OccluSense® used in combination with the OccluSense® sensors is applied
exactly like conventional occlusion test foils. The patient masticatory
pressure distribution is recorded digitally in 256 pressure levels and
then transmitted to the OccluSense® – iPad app for further evaluation.
Recordings are stored in the patient management system of the iPad and
can be reviewed or exported at any time.
OccluSense® Electronic Pressure Sensor.
The thin and flexible material permits the recording of both static and dynamic occlusion. Additionally, the red color coated sensor marks the occlusal contacts on the patient’s teeth.
